‘Best Visiting Company’ award for Aurora at the Young Enterprise Trade Fair in Ballymena

In September, thirteen year 13 students became directors of this year’s Young Enterprise company, ‘Aurora’, and co-ordinated a strategy which enabled us to compile our final portfolio of products which consisted of necklaces, cookie catchers, ‘pot-pourri jars with a difference’ and a range of seasonal items.

Our company proved successful at the Young Enterprise Trade Fair in Ballymena on 3nd December, where we were delighted to win the ‘Best Visiting Company’ award.

We sold many products and achieved great feedback from both our customers and a wide range of judges on the day. Overall we had a very good experience and exceeded our expectations. We now look forward to our next public selling opportunity in the Kennedy Centre in January.
